The Financial Accountant will be responsible for the following:
Preparation of consolidated monthly management accounts for the Group
Tracking costs against Budget to identify cost savings/ efficiencies
Monthly reporting and financial analysis on P&L and Balance sheet
Prepare quarterly financial reporting information for investors
Ownership of the parent company P&L and balance sheet and checking accuracy
Performing audit quality reconciliations across P&L and balance sheet
Reviewing accounting policies and check financial statement in line with accounting standards
Supporting with internal and external audit requirements
Reviewing and setting up weekly payment runs
Preparing and submitting VAT returns
Liaising with third parties i.e. External auditors, banks, HMRC
Supporting and covering the Financial Controller with any other ad-hoc duties as required
